Transaction 38990ed23e0b5f2e2953dd581681c76b099bd234668d62125fcb2ec3d0ea55ae
1 Input
1 Output
-
38990ed23e0b5f2e2953dd581681c76b099bd234668d62125fcb2ec3d0ea55ae:0
- value
- 738569
- script pubkey
- OP_0 OP_PUSHBYTES_20 3d9b73534510541df7d14bc4cb844ca9c80c67b4
- address
- bc1q8kdhx569zp2pma73f0zvhpzv48yqcea5t87mu6